Step by Step Staking
Step 1
Staking is the act of actively setting aside your DEV tokens in your Wallet to deposit them in your favorite Creator pool on stakes.social. To buy DEV Token, you need an ETH on your wallet to convert it to $DEV.
Step 2
After you buy DEV Token, add the DEV token address in your wallet. You need to find a project that you like on Stakes.social. If you find a project interesting, you can click on the banner, the project page will show up, there you can find the description and some useful things like Github, Twitter pages, YouTube channel, Website, etc. This could help you decide to stake your $DEV. On the blue box, you can type a specific amount of DEV you want to stake on that project, or you can just click on DEV, and the total amount of DEV in your wallet will automatically show on that box.
Step 3
After that, you can click on the blue Stake button and a transaction approval message will pop up in your wallet, you can check out the amount of gas required to Stake, by clicking approve, your DEV will be deposited on the contract and it will be staked. Once staked refresh the page and your DEV will show on the โYour Staking Amountโ box. You will instantly start receiving Rewards and so will the Creator that you chose, those can also be seen on the dashboard.
Step 4
If you still canโt decide, my tip is, visit the official Discord or Telegram channel and ask the community. Always try to stake and reward active developers that promote DEV, this will be good for everyone on the long run.

HiDE
HiDE is a decentralized blogging platform from Japan. In Japan, blogging projects like Steem It did not last, but they used the Dev Protocol to monetize blog posts and create a sustainable reward distribution model for users. They are a newly founded startup, but have made $60,000 in revenue in six months with Stakes.social and are about to start giving back to their blog users.
Sindre
He is one of the most influential independent developers in the OSS fields. He has developed over 1000 OSS projects and lives as a full-time Open Sourcer. One of his famous OSS project, Chalk is downloaded 90 million times a week, but he only receives $360 a month in donations on Patreon. He has been involved with Dev Protocol as an MVP user since 2019, and has given back about $2.1M in revenue earned there to GitHub's most active developers this year.

Step by Step Onboarding
Step 1
In order for you to register (or tokenize) your Open Source Project to Dev Protocol, you need to go through a registration procedure for Stakes.social. Youโll need a wallet to register, so you must have one beforehand. You can use any wallet provided there like MetaMask to log in on Stakes.social.
Step 2
Click the โSign inโ button located at the right side of the navigation bar to connect your wallet to Stakes.social and it will automatically login if you successfully connect your wallet to the Stakes.social.
Step 3
Click the "Create" in navigation bar and answer the provided form. After you submit your application form, we kindly ask you to wait for about a week for the screening process. Weโll let you know the result via email, so please change the filtering setup for your mail box to receive an email from โ@devprotocol.xyzโ.
Step 4
If you successfully pass the screening, access the URL written in the approval email. We will send you another step-by-step method to completely onboard to the Stakes.social. Youโll need a gas fee for your registration. It fluctuates depending on the congestion condition, however, it would be around 0.0436ETH. Since the gas costs are constantly changing, it is safer to separate about 0.0875 ETH for the onboarding process.(edited)

Write code that fetches all the blog posts by devprotocol on medium, Then converts it into markup styled with Tailwind CSS
To be implemented in vue or astro
Styling to be done with Tailwind CSS
Dev Protocol Medium: https://medium.com/devprtcl
RSS Feed: https://medium.com/feed/devprtcl
Design to be achieved:
Design File available at figma
For more information/support/opportunities to contribute join our discord server
To be implemented at: https://github.com/web3community/devprotocol.xyz/blob/main/src/pages/index.astro#L70-L76
Discussed on Discord
Use this API: https://api.rss2json.com/v1/api.json?rss_url=https://medium.com/feed/devprtcl
Fetch it using: https://docs.astro.build/guides/data-fetching#fetch
If you are familiar to jsx, here is how to repeat the array into generating blog posts: https://docs.astro.build/core-concepts/astro-components#comparing-astro-versus-jsx
This is a example of somewhat how you have to build it:
---
const blogs = (await (await Astro.fetch('https://api.rss2json.com/v1/api.json?rss_url=https://medium.com/feed/devprtcl')).json())
// Let's assume the response were to be [{ title: 'Blog Post' }, img: '<img_url>'}, { title: 'Blog Post' }, img: '<img_url>'}]
---
<ul>
{blogs.map(blog => <li><img src="{blog.img}"><h4>{blog.title}</h4></li>)}
</ul>
Also use tailwindcss classes to style the components.
Note: This is just example markup, please use more structured and semantic markup. The response also might not be the one displayed since it was just for a example.
